Levitt, Gertrude H. Kaplan was born on January 18, 1919 in New York, United States. Daughter of Jacob Kaplan and Dora Laskey.
Bachelor, Hunter College, 1939.
Executive secretary, Coca-Cola Company. New York City, 1940-1943; censor, Censorship Bureau, New York City, 1943-1945; executive secretary, Netherlands Information Bureau, New York City, 1945-1947; executive secretary, Burlington Mills (Princeton Knitting Mills), New York City, 1948-1955; assistant to president, Lumber Industries Inc., Brooklyn, New York, 1956-1966; real estate broker,, New York City, 1966-1975.
Fundraiser Women's American Organization for Rehabilitation through Training International, 1975-1990. Volunteer Canine Companions. Member Hunter College Alumni Association.
Married Jack Levitt, June 15, 1978.
